Advantages of Cold Mix Asphalt



What benefits does cold mix asphalt deal over standard warm mix asphalt in road building jobs? One vital benefit is its capacity to be utilized in all weather condition problems, unlike warm mix asphalt which needs particular temperature level conditions for laying and mixing.


Additionally, cold mix asphalt can be stockpiled for future use, providing convenience and price financial savings for upkeep tasks. Its ease of application, requiring no specialized devices or home heating, makes it ideal for quick repair services and patching. Additionally, cool mix asphalt is extra eco pleasant as it calls for much less energy for manufacturing and gives off lower levels of greenhouse gases compared to warm mix asphalt. These benefits integrated make cold mix asphalt a flexible and reliable selection for numerous roadway construction jobs.

Environmental Benefits



Cold mix asphalt's ecological advantages add dramatically to its allure as a lasting option for road building and construction jobs. One of the key ecological benefits of chilly mix asphalt is its lower carbon footprint contrasted to hot mix asphalt. The manufacturing procedure of cold mix asphalt calls for much less energy since it can be made and used at reduced temperature levels, decreasing greenhouse gas emissions. Furthermore, cold mix asphalt is often used recycled materials such as reclaimed asphalt sidewalk (RAP) and recycled asphalt roof shingles (RAS), further reducing the need for new basic materials and diverting waste from garbage dumps.


Moreover, making use of cold mix asphalt can bring about decreased energy consumption during building and construction as a result of its ability to be applied utilizing typical equipment without the requirement for additional heating procedures. This not just minimizes gas intake however additionally minimizes air pollution and enhances air top quality in the bordering areas. By selecting cool mix asphalt for roadway jobs, building companies can make a favorable effect on the atmosphere while still guaranteeing resilient and high-quality roadway surfaces.

Cost-Effectiveness and Sustainability



Considering the ecological and financial impacts of roadway building materials, how does the cost-effectiveness and sustainability of cool mix asphalt compare to conventional choices? In terms of cost-effectiveness, chilly mix asphalt usually requires lower production temperature levels, reducing power usage and manufacturing expenses compared to warm mix asphalt.


From a sustainability perspective, cold mix asphalt provides numerous ecological advantages. Its lower manufacturing temperatures result in lowered greenhouse gas discharges and energy intake, straightening with initiatives to mitigate environment change. The capability to recycle existing materials into chilly mix asphalt contributes Web Site to a circular economic situation technique, lowering the need for virgin products and decreasing total environmental effect. In general, the cost-effectiveness and sustainability of chilly mix asphalt make it a promising option to typical roadway building and construction materials.


Influence On Road Sturdiness





Roadway toughness dramatically affects the long-term efficiency and upkeep needs of asphalt pavements. Cold mix asphalt, with its unique attributes, has a notable influence on road toughness. One vital facet is the capability of chilly mix asphalt to endure temperature level variations without compromising its structural honesty. This versatility aids the pavement to resist cracking and rutting triggered by changing climate conditions, resulting in a longer service life for the road.


Moreover, the chilly mix asphalt's boosted resistance to wetness damage plays a crucial function in preserving roadway sturdiness. Traditional hot mix asphalt is more prone to wetness infiltration, which can weaken the pavement framework over time. On the other hand, cold mix asphalt's make-up enables it to much visit this site right here better stand up to water infiltration, decreasing the probability of pits and various other kinds of deterioration.
